BehLand is committed to maintaining a secure, transparent, and trustworthy ecosystem. We welcome responsible security research and encourage the community to report potential vulnerabilities in a responsible manner.
This security policy applies to:
- Smart contract implementations
- Token-related infrastructure
- Documentation repositories
- Public-facing services operated by BehLand
Issues related to user behavior, social engineering, or third-party platforms are outside the scope of this policy.
